Do I need climbing experience?

No — Kilimanjaro requires no technical climbing skills or equipment like ropes or crampons. It's a long, high-altitude trek, not a technical mountaineering ascent.

How fit do I need to be?

Reasonable fitness helps you enjoy the days more, but pacing and acclimatization matter more to summit success than athletic performance. See our training guide for specific preparation advice.

Which route should I choose?

It depends on your priorities: Machame for proven scenery and popularity, Lemosho for the best acclimatization, Marangu for hut accommodation, Rongai for solitude and dry-season reliability, and Umbwe for the quietest, most direct climb.

Is it safe?

Climbing with a reputable operator using experienced guides, proper acclimatization pacing and emergency protocols makes Kilimanjaro a safe undertaking for the vast majority of climbers.

What's the best time to climb?

June-October and January-March are the two dry-season windows; see our best time to climb guide for details.

Can I climb Kilimanjaro solo?
You can join as an individual on a group departure or arrange a fully private climb — either way, you're never alone on the mountain, as solo trekking without a licensed guide isn't permitted.
What toilets are available on the mountain?
Camps have basic long-drop toilets; portable toilet tents are also available as an upgrade on request.
Will I get phone signal on the mountain?
Signal is patchy and unreliable above the lower camps; treat the climb as a genuine digital break.
